What is the USDA Community Facilities Direct Loan Program?
The USDA Community Facilities Direct Loan Program is designed to support vital facilities in rural areas, including healthcare clinics, schools, and public safety buildings. This program primarily helps public entities, nonprofit corporations, and tribal governments secure much-needed funding for community infrastructure. By facilitating access to financing, the program plays a crucial role in enhancing the quality of life in rural communities.
Purpose and Benefits of the USDA Community Facilities Direct Loan Program
This program aims to provide funding that is pivotal for the development of essential community services. Notably, financial assistance is available for healthcare clinics, educational institutions, and public safety buildings, ensuring these facilities can better serve their communities.
One of the main advantages of the USDA Community Facilities Direct Loan Program is the provision of low-interest loans with extended repayment terms, lasting up to 40 years. Eligibility Criteria for the USDA Community Facilities Direct Loan Program
To qualify for the USDA Community Facilities Direct Loan Program, applicants must meet specific eligibility requirements based on their legal status and the proposed project’s location. Generally, qualified applicants include public entities, nonprofit corporations, and tribal governments actively working on community development.

Who is eligible to apply for the USDA Community Facilities Direct Loan Program?
Eligibility includes public entities, nonprofit corporations, and tribal governments in rural areas seeking funding for community facilities such as schools, healthcare clinics, and public safety buildings.
What types of projects can be funded through this program?
The program funds a range of essential community facilities including healthcare clinics, schools, and buildings for public safety departments in rural areas.
What supporting documents do I need to submit with the loan application?
Applicants typically need to provide detailed project information, legal documentation, financial statements, and evidence of funding sources along with the completed application.
